US President Donald Trump has issued a stern warning to Iran. He desires a deal before April 6.
Key takeaways
Quick scan — what you need to know:
- US President Donald Trump has issued a stern warning to Iran.
- He desires a deal before April 6.
- If Iran does not reopen the Strait of Hormuz, US forces may target its energy infrastructure.
- This includes power plants and oil wells.
